    Description

    220: Statistical Methods.
    Goal: To introduce students to the logic of designing an experiment and interpreting the quantitative data derived from it.
    Content: A study of the binomial and normal distributions, measures of central tendency, tests of hypotheses, chi-square tests, tests for homogeneity and independence, confidence intervals, regression, and correlation.
    Taught: Fall, Spring.
    Prerequisite: MAT 126, 130, 140, 192, or equivalent placement.
    Gen. Ed. Category: Developing; Quantitative Reasoning Competency; (SM).
    Credit: 3 hours; cross-listed as PSY 220
